Last week, our second-grade students enjoyed a fun field trip to Young’s Jersey Dairy in Yellow Springs. The trip introduced them to the world of dairy farming.
They began their visit with an educational “MOOvie” at The Dairy Tale Theatre, followed by a wagon ride around the farm. Students had the opportunity to feed goats in the livestock petting barn, and they were especially excited to meet and milk “Jenny,” the farm’s model Jersey cow.
To wrap up the day, everyone enjoyed a scoop of Young’s famous homemade ice cream. It was a fun, hands-on learning experience that brought the classroom to life in the best way.

Our fifth-grade students recently explored the work of contemporary artist Andy Burgess, drawing inspiration from his vibrant collages created while living in New York City. Burgess is known for artwork that captures iconic landmarks and scenes from his community.
Inspired by this approach, artists in Miss Marshall’s art class reflected on the places and features that make our own community special and incorporated them into their final project.
Rather than using glue, students challenged themselves by sewing their collages—a technique that not only adds texture and depth to their artwork but also teaches them a lifelong skill. Miss Marshall taught them that sewing can be both creative and practical, offering a way to repair and restore items rather than replace them.
